Abstract
A novel series of 6-amino-pyrido[2,3-d]pyrimidine-2,4-dione derivatives 3a-s were synthesized and evaluated as new inhibitors for α-glucosidase. All synthesized compounds were superior to standard drug (acarbose). Particularly, compound 3o was around 10-fold more potent than standard drug. The kinetic analysis of the compound 3o revealed that this compound inhibited α-glucosidase in a competitive manner (Kiâ¯=â¯69.2â¯Î¼M). Docking studies of the most active compounds 3o, 3i, 3e, and 3m were also performed.112
